After a long summer of committee debates and discussions with constituents, health care reform is finally out in the open on the Senate floor -- but it doesn't include much of anything to lower drug prices. And the big drug companies are pulling out all the stops to keep it that way. I've offered a bipartisan amendment that would give the American people the freedom to purchase prescription drugs from other countries at a fraction of the ...
